The investor should obtain conditional residency by sending an I-485 request. This request must be sent within 6 months of the I-526 approval and have to include proof that the financial investment was made and that it has created at the very least 10 full-time work for united state workers. The USCIS will evaluate the I-485 request and either approve it or request added evidence.


Within 90 days of the conditional residency expiration date, the financier needs to submit an I-829 application to eliminate the conditions on their residency. This application needs to include proof that the investment was sustained which it developed at least 10 full-time work for united state employees. If the I-829 request is approved, the investor and their household participants will certainly be approved long-term residency in the USA Call us for even more aid concerning the application demands.

The minimum amount of funding needed for the EB-5 visa program may be decreased from $1,050,000 to $800,000 if the financial investment is made in an industrial entity that is located in a targeted work area (TEA). To get approved for the TEA designation, the EB-5 job should either be in a backwoods or in a location that has high unemployment.
